Well, today I found a bug in Safari 4. I'll tell you what it is later, but I want to right now talk about the bug reporting system. My issue revolves around the Safari preferences, and I wanted to send it to Apple. Well, when you click on the "Send Bug Report" button it assumes that your bug revolves around problems with a web page. Well, there is no button for that. There is only "Other" and when you select it, it still asks if you want to include a webpage screenshot. 
My problem is pretty simple, really. In my install of Safari 4, the cookie functionality keeps switching itself off. So, every time I try to login to a site that I'm already logged in to, it sends me back to the login page because it can't write the appropriate cookie. So, I have to switch it back on.
This really isn't a significant problem, but it is pretty annoying to me.
